The Museum of Modern Art
11 West 53 Street, New York, N.Y.10019 Circle 5-8900 Cable:Modernart

Richard H. Koch
Director of Administration
April 20, 1965

Poindexter Gallery
21 West 56th Street
New York, New York

Gentlemen:

Thank you for informing us of the sale of the Gene Davis painting, "Black-Gray Beat", which is currently in our exhibition, "The Responsive Eye".

We understand that the picture was sold to Mr. Vincent Melzac for $2,500. As is specified on the loan agreement regarding this work, the selling price is understood to include a 10% handling charge for the Museum of Modern Art, and we are accordingly enclosing herewith our bill in the amount of $250.

With all good wishes,

Sincerely yours,

[[in signature]] Richard H Koch

Enc.

just advise them it sold for 1000 & pay the 10% on that. [[signature]]
